首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 109 毫秒
1.
为解决可逆指令集PISA缺少乘法指令和除法指令的问题,提出一种通过可逆子过程实现乘除法指令的方法。研究PISA指令集中的现有指令,总结并概括使用可逆指令进行编程的方法和原则,分析设计可逆乘除法指令须遵守的约束,给出可逆乘除法指令的格式,分别使用可逆的原码一位乘和恢复余数法实现乘法指令和除法指令。在可逆指令集仿真平台上对实现的乘除法指令进行测试,测试结果表明,乘法指令和除法指令均逻辑可逆,在满足特定约束条件时互为逆指令。  相似文献   

2.
RISC-V作为精简指令集的代表,也会反映一些精简指令集的弊端,程序体积偏大就是其中之一.在精简指令集(RISC)中,实现一些复杂操作所需要的指令条数普遍会多于复杂指令集(CISC),进而导致最后生成的二进制程序体积相较CISC程序更大.并且嵌入式设备的RAM和ROM普遍较小,因此在嵌入式场景中,程序的体积变得尤为重要.为了在现有压缩指令集的基础上尽可能的优化RISC-V程序代码体积, RISC-V指令集子扩展Zce制定了一系列指令.其中以LWGP为代表的一系列指令被用来减少加载/存储字节数据时的指令条数.本文分析了以LWGP为代表的指令对于代码体积的优化原理并且将之实现在LLD链接器上,通过分析使用LWGP等指令前后程序体积的变化评估对于二进制程序体积优化的效率并且提出后续改进建议.  相似文献   

3.
提出集束式整数线性规划形式化模型,利用指令间的功能依赖性解决专用指令集处理器中指令集自动定制的指数性空间问题.在此基础上,针对其前端和后端分别提出了相应的指令定制实现策略.实验结果表明,该指令定制方法可以有效地实现专用指令集的自动设计,并使最终处理器的运算性能得到优化.  相似文献   

4.
利用虚拟指令作为中间语言来构建可重用指令集模拟器是解决模拟器可重用性的重要技术.介绍了可重用指令集模拟器的工作原理,提出了虚拟指令的构建原则和方法,描述了对汇编指令的语义规则,最后举例说明如何从汇编指令的语义描述规则出发,生成与目标指令语义等价的虚拟指令.  相似文献   

5.
在分析ARM指令集的寻址方式、寄存器个数、指令周期数等特征的基础上,考虑三级流水线对指令集能耗特征的影响,提出一种层次分类能耗测量方法。实验结果验证了该方法的有效性,得出指令集能耗与电流值和指令周期数的乘积呈正比,减少指令周期数能降低指令集能耗,并且3种应用程序用例在仿真平台HMSim的测量值与W90P710实际目标板的能耗值相接近,绝对误差在10%以内。  相似文献   

6.
基于微指令覆盖的最小指令集测试算法   总被引:1,自引:0,他引:1  
张盛兵  高德远  樊晓桠 《计算机学报》2000,23(10):1083-1087
着重讨论了如何利用微处理器中的自测试设计来缩短功能测试序列的长度,首先,依据指令的表示模型,将指令测试分成微指令序列和微指令执行两个测试层次,提出了一个基于微指令覆盖的最小指令集测试算法,只需检测指令集的子集就能达到指令测试的目的。然后,通过定义指令的测试代价和测试效率,提出了一个可以有效地选择最小测试指令集的方法,最后,将算法应用于NRS4000微处理器的功能测试,仅为传统的全指令集测试序列的3  相似文献   

7.
网络处理嚣是专门为网络处理而设计的处理嚣,其指令集是软硬件的界面,指令集的设计对性能有较大的影响.本文提出了一种针对高频率指令对-HFIP的组合优化方法,该方法充分利用了网络处理器基准程序里指令执行过程中的动态相关性,开发了simpIescalar模拟嚣的指令格式里未使用的空住作为新指令的扩展域.采用量化的方法对实验结果进行分析.模拟结果显示该方法合理有效,在提高网络处理器性能的同时有效降低指令cache的功耗.实现性能/功耗的权衡.  相似文献   

8.
80C196KB的指令集是8096BH指令集的完全增强集,即在8096BH指令集的基础上增加了五条新指令,使得指令系统功能更强;其二、指令执行速度更快,特别是在变址/间址数据操作时;其三、时钟由8096BH的三分频改为二分频,使得指令执行时间更短、编程效率更高、更适合于实时运算及控制。  相似文献   

9.
ARMv4指令集模拟器设计及优化技术   总被引:3,自引:0,他引:3  
指令集模拟器是处理器、编译器以及嵌入式系统设计中的重要工具之一.首先讨论指令集模拟器的分类及特点,然后阐述作者采用解释技术开发的ARMv4指令集模拟器的实现方法,为了提高模拟效率,还讨论几种性能优化技术.  相似文献   

10.
本文介绍了一种比较简单而又具有较高故障覆盖率的微处理器测试方法──最小指令集测试法。它应用最小指令集的概念来测试微处理器的指令系统,对于最小指令集以内和以外的指令采用不同的测试方法,从而简化了指令系统的测试。此方法算法简单,易于实现,是一种较为可行的微处理器功能测试方法,已将其应用于TMS320C25的测试。  相似文献   

11.
Agent是人工智能及计算机软件领域内的一个新兴技术.文章探讨了Agent技术以及如何把Agent技术应用于网络教学中,以提高网络教学系统的智能性,并给出了智能Agent在网络教学系统中的应用模式与实现方法.简要分析了Agent技术给网络教育带来的优点.  相似文献   

12.
为了产生雷达天线系统测试时所需的自检信号、速度指令等信号,设计了一种基于基于 C8051F206和FT245R的混合信号生成系统。该系统利用FT245R USB接口芯片实现与上位机通信,并依靠C8051F206高程控性和C语言的高灵活性,可靠地响应上位机指令并实时发送被测件所需的自检信号、速度指令等信号源。介绍了混合信号生成系统硬件设计和软件设计的原理。实际应用表明,该系统能准确地生成被测件雷达天线系统所需的自检信号、速度指令信号,并实时地反馈测试结果。  相似文献   

13.
本文基于C 技术的优势,利用C 模板类进行系统模块开发的核心思想和精髓,对教学课件软件的开发进行了指导,并进一步阐述了软件包其应用效果。  相似文献   

14.
本文对基于网络的多媒体计算机辅助教学系统作了一定的研究,提出了开发分布式的Web应用系统框架的网络的多媒体计算机辅助教学设计方案,将系统划分为三层体系结构来加以实现。着重说明了内容发布、多媒体模块、数据管理、选课,在线交流,课程设置等六个子模块的功能及实现方法,并就多媒体网络发布的解决方案作了详细说明,在传统计算机辅助教学软件的功能基础上实现了多媒体和网络支持的特性,并将教学资源管理提升到一个统一的电子化平台中。  相似文献   

15.
主要介绍了济钢三炼钢中厚板一体化MES系统的设计思路,从需求分析,整体目标以及软件、硬件架构平台的实现上做了详细的说明.从业务建模的11个方面进行了功能解释,对于APS/ALS等MES平台软件的接口使用以及控制权限进行归纳.MES一体化生产管理系统的应用为企业的生产制造、管理提供了一个标准化的信息平台.  相似文献   

16.
Silberman  G.M. Ebcioglu  K. 《Computer》1993,26(6):39-56
An architectural framework that allows software applications and operating system code written for a given instruction set to migrate to different, higher performance architectures is described. The framework provides a hardware mechanism that enhances application performance while keeping the same program behavior from a user perspective. The framework is designed to accommodate program exceptions, self-modifying code, tracing, and debugging. Examples are given for IBM System/390 operating-system code and AIX utilities, showing the performance potential of the scheme using a very long instruction word (VLIW) machine as the high-performance target architecture  相似文献   

17.
This study was designed to develop practical and effective teaching strategies of computer application software for group instruction at Tamkang University. The assumption was that practical strategies for learning computer application software that were highly organized, provided hands-on learning, and proceeded in small steps would be successful in increasing the skill level of students. It utilized the cognitive concept of “scaffolding” that novice should be assisted at the beginning and promoted to self-learning. At the first stage, students and instructors evaluated four Microsoft PowerPoint instructional CD-ROMs and an instructional CD-ROM was developed according to the designing principles of the evaluation. Secondly, interviews were employed to gather data from the instructors and students of introductory computer courses. Based on the criteria defined by literature review and interview, instructional strategies for computer application software learning for group instruction were developed. These strategies and designing guidelines were further implemented and revised by selected instructors. Formative evaluation of instructional strategies and designing guidelines for instructional CD-ROM were conducted with participant observation and interview. Instructional strategies, which included motivation, organization, demonstration, practice, and transfer stages, were developed for evaluation. After the evaluation, instructors reported that these strategies provided them a systematic and efficient approach in designing their instruction and the instructional CD-ROM were helpful to the group instruction process. The students concluded that the new instructional processes were more motivating, organized and interacting. However, students suggested they need more time for practice during group instruction. They recommended that the instructional CD-ROM could take the major role of individualized instruction after 4–6 h of group instruction.  相似文献   

18.
互联网技术的软件开发模式已经逐步成为大型应用软件开发的首选,传统的B/S软件开发结构已逐步显现出自身的缺陷,RIA架构的推出无疑为B/S应用开发注入了活力。本文首先分析了传统的软件开发结构(C/S和B/S)的优缺点,然后介绍了RIA技术及其优势,最后设计了一个基于RIA与传统B/S的混合教学评价系统。  相似文献   

19.
本文以嵌入式应用为背景,提出了一种基于NIOSII的指纹采集系统设计方案,给出了该系统的硬件设计结构和软件算法,并利用NIOSII定制指令来加速实现指纹图像预处理算法。实验结果表明,该系统能够有效采集指纹数据,实时处理并获取指纹有用信息,提高指纹图像增强的效果和速度。  相似文献   

20.
基于Authorware的多媒体教学软件设计研究   总被引:9,自引:1,他引:9  
提出多媒体教学软件的框架模型,论述基于Authorware的多媒体教学软件的设计过程。并以EC实例给出教学系统结构、教学内容文件网络结构、软件详细设计及教学测试系统框架、功能。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号